.cst_cat_drawer .cst_cart_heading{font-size:15px;width:100%;margin:0;padding-bottom:0;letter-spacing:0px;text-align:center;line-height:1;color:#221F20;font-family:Hind;font-weight:500}.cst_cat_drawer .cst_cart_heading .cst_cat_icon{display:flex}.cst_cat_drawer .cst_cart_heading span{line-height:normal;width:auto}.cst_cat_drawer .cart-item .cart-remove-button span.cart-remove-text{cursor:pointer;font-size:12px;font-weight:300;letter-spacing:0px;color:#969696;text-decoration:underline;text-underline-offset:1px}.cart-drawer .cart-item__image{width:100%;height:100%;border-radius:10px;object-fit:contain}.cst_cat_drawer .cart-item__details .cst-cart-item-price{font-size:15px;line-height:1;margin:18px 0 0;letter-spacing:0px;color:#717171}.cst_cat_drawer .cart-item__quantity-wrapper .cart-item__error{margin:0px!important}.cst_cat_drawer .cst_cart_item td.cart-item__media[headers="CartDrawer-ColumnProductImage"]{width:70px;max-height:70px;border-radius:10px}.cst_cat_drawer .drawer__header{display:block;padding:0 20px}.cst_cat_drawer .drawer__header .cart_heading_with_icon{border-bottom:1px solid #E6E6E6;padding:14px 0}.cst_cat_drawer .drawer__header .cart_heading_with_icon{display:flex;align-items:center}.cst_cat_drawer .drawer__header .cart_heading_with_icon .cart_icon{line-height:0}.cst_cat_drawer .drawer__footer .cart-drawer__footer .totals{margin:0 0 3px;border-top:1px solid #E6E6E6;padding-top:10px}.cst_cat_drawer .drawer__footer .cart-drawer__footer .tax-note,.cst_cat_drawer .drawer__footer .cart-drawer__footer .tax-note a{margin:0 0 13px;color:#969696;font-size:12px;line-height:normal;font-weight:300}.cart_drawer_vendor{margin-bottom:2px;display:block;letter-spacing:0px;color:#868686;opacity:1;font-size:12px;text-transform:inherit}.cart-item__error{margin:0px!important}.drawer__inner .pro_available{display:flex;gap:8px;margin-bottom:22px}.drawer__inner .pro_available span{font-size:13px;color:#009B3C;font-weight:500}.cart_trust_badge{padding:0 20px 16px;display:flex}.cart_trust_badge span{color:#221F20;font-size:13px;line-height:1}.cart_trust_badge li{display:flex;gap:5px;align-items:center;padding-right:9px;flex:auto}.cart_trust_badge li+li{border-left:1px solid #221f20;padding-left:9px}.cart_trust_badge li:last-child{padding-right:0}.cst_cat_drawer .drawer__footer{border:none;padding:10px 0px 20px}.cst_cat_drawer .drawer__header .drawer__close{min-width:24px;min-height:24px;display:flex;align-items:center;justify-content:center;right:10px;top:50%;transform:translateY(-50%)}.cst_cat_drawer button.drawer__close span{line-height:0}.cst_cat_drawer .cst_cart_item{grid-template:repeat(2,auto) / repeat(5,1fr);padding-bottom:16px;row-gap:0px;margin-bottom:16px;border-bottom:1px solid #E6E6E6}.cst_cat_drawer .cst_cart_item:last-child{margin:0px!important}.cst_cat_drawer .cart-item__quantity-wrapper .quantity:after{box-shadow:none}.cst_cat_drawer .cart-item__quantity-wrapper .quantity button.quantity__button{min-width:auto;width:1.6rem;height:1.6rem;margin:0;opacity:1}.cst_cat_drawer .cart-item__quantity-wrapper .quantity button.quantity__button svg g{fill:#000}.cst_cat_drawer .cart-item__quantity-wrapper .quantity button.quantity__button .svg-wrapper{width:7px;height:7px}.cst_cat_drawer .cart-item__quantity-wrapper .quantity{max-height:24px!important;align-items:center;width:66px;border:1px solid #D6D6D6;border-radius:12px;min-height:auto}.cst_cat_drawer .cart-item__quantity-wrapper .quantity__input{font-size:16px;opacity:1;letter-spacing:0px;color:#464646;font-family:Hind;line-height:normal;max-height:22px;font-weight:400}.cst_cat_drawer .cart-items .cart-item__quantity{grid-column:auto;display:flex;flex-direction:column}.cst_cat_drawer .cart-item .cart-remove-button{margin-top:auto;padding:0;text-align:end;min-height:15px;min-width:auto;cursor:pointer}.cst_cat_drawer .cart-item__quantity-wrapper{flex-direction:column;row-gap:19px}.cst_cat_drawer .cart-item__quantity quantity-popover{display:flex;flex-direction:column;gap:5px}.cst_cat_drawer .cart-item cart-remove-button{justify-content:end}.cst_cat_drawer .cart-item>td+td{padding:0!important}.cst_cat_drawer .cart-items td{padding-top:0rem;width:auto}.cst_cat_drawer .cart-item__details{grid-column:2 / 5}.cst_cat_drawer .cart-item__quantity .quantity-popover-container{justify-content:end}.cst_cat_drawer .cart-item__details{display:flex;flex-direction:column;gap:0}.cst_cat_drawer .drawer__inner{width:46.1rem;padding:0}.cst_cat_drawer .cart-drawer__footer .totals .totals__total,.cst_cat_drawer .cart-drawer__footer .totals .totals__total-value{font-size:15px;line-height:1;font-weight:500;letter-spacing:0px;margin:0;color:#221F20;font-family:Hind}.cst_cat_drawer .payment_icon{margin:0;padding:0px;list-style-type:none;display:flex;flex-wrap:wrap;gap:10px}.cst_cat_drawer .payment_icon li{display:flex}.cst_cat_drawer .cart__ctas{display:flex;flex-direction:column;gap:1rem;padding:0 20px}.cart-drawer__footer{padding:0px 20px 0}.cart_payment_icon{padding:0 20px;display:flex;margin-top:18px;gap:12px}.cart_payment_icon li img{width:100%}.cart_payment_icon li{line-height:0;max-width:41px;width:100%}.cart_trust_badge li img{max-width:10px;height:10px;margin-top:1px}.cst_cat_drawer .drawer__footer .cart-drawer__footer .tax-note p{margin:0;font-size:12px}@media screen and (max-width:749px){.cst_cat_drawer .cart-drawer__footer .totals .totals__total,.cst_cat_drawer .cart-drawer__footer .totals .totals__total-value{font-size:15px}.drawer__footer{padding:10px 0 32px}.cst_cat_drawer button.drawer__close{right:13px}.cst_cat_drawer .cart-item .cart-remove-button span.cart-remove-text{font-size:13px}.cst_cat_drawer .drawer__footer .cart-drawer__footer .tax-note{margin:0 0 13px;font-size:13px}.cst_cat_drawer .cart__ctas{padding:0 20px}.cart-drawer__footer{padding:0 20px 0}cart-drawer-items{padding:16px 20px 12px}.cst_cat_drawer .cst_cart_item{padding-bottom:15px;margin-bottom:15px}.cart_trust_badge li{gap:4px}.cart_trust_badge span{font-size:12px}.cart_trust_badge{padding:0 20px 13px}}@media screen and (max-width:480px){.cart_trust_badge li{padding-right:20px}.cart_trust_badge li+li{padding-left:20px}.cart_trust_badge span{font-size:10px}#CartDrawer{width:100%}.cst_cat_drawer .drawer__inner{width:100%;max-width:100%}}@media screen and (max-width:424px){.cart_trust_badge li{padding-right:11px}.cart_trust_badge li+li{padding-left:11px}}@media screen and (max-width:390px){.cart_trust_badge li{padding-right:7px}.cart_trust_badge li+li{padding-left:7px}}@media screen and (max-width:374px){.drawer__inner .pro_available span{font-size:13px}.cart_trust_badge span{font-size:9px}.cst_cat_drawer .drawer__header{padding:0 15px}.cart_trust_badge{padding:0 15px 13px}.cst_cat_drawer .cart__ctas,.cart-drawer__footer,.cart_payment_icon{padding:0 15px}cart-drawer-items{padding:16px 15px 12px}.cart_trust_badge li img{max-width:8px;height:8px}.cart_trust_badge li{padding-right:4px}.cart_trust_badge li+li{padding-left:4px}}.cart__footer .totals{margin:0px 0px 9px;column-gap:20px}.cart__footer .tax-note{margin:0px 0px 17px;letter-spacing:0px;color:#848484;font-size:13px;line-height:1.6;font-weight:300}.cart__footer .tax-note a{color:#848484}.cart__footer .totals .totals__total,.cart__footer .totals .totals__total-value{font-size:16px;font-weight:500;letter-spacing:0px;color:#1d1d1b;margin:0}.cart-item cart-remove-button a.button.button--tertiary{border:0px}.cart-item__details .cart-item__name{font-size:18px;font-weight:400;letter-spacing:0px;color:#000;text-decoration:none}th.caption-with-letter-spacing{font-size:16px;font-weight:500;letter-spacing:0px;color:#1d1d1b;text-transform:inherit!important}.cart-item__details .product-option{font-size:16px;font-weight:400;letter-spacing:0px;color:#3b3b3b}.cart-item__totals span.price.price--end{font-size:18px;font-weight:400;letter-spacing:0px;color:#3b3b3b}.template-cart .cart-item__quantity-wrapper .quantity:after{box-shadow:none}.template-cart .cart-item__quantity-wrapper .quantity button.quantity__button{min-width:auto;width:1.9rem;height:1.9rem;margin:0;opacity:1}.template-cart .cart-item__quantity-wrapper .quantity{min-height:40px!important;align-items:center;width:120px;border:1px solid #D6D6D6;padding:0px 5px}.template-cart .cart-item__quantity-wrapper .quantity__input{font-size:17px;line-height:27px;letter-spacing:0px;color:#1D1D1B;opacity:1}.cart-items .caption-with-letter-spacing{color:#000;opacity:1}.drawer__footer .cart__dynamic-checkout-buttons shopify-accelerated-checkout-cart{--shopify-accelerated-checkout-inline-alignment:flex-start}.wallet-cart-grid{flex-wrap:wrap}.wallet-cart-button-container,.wallet-cart-button{width:100%}.cart_page .cart__warnings{padding:0}.cart_page .cart__empty-text{margin-top:0}.cart_page cart-items.is-empty{padding-bottom:60px}@media screen and (max-width:749px){.cart-item__details .cart-item__name{font-size:15px}.cart__footer .totals .totals__total,.cart__footer .totals .totals__total-value{font-size:15px}.cart-item__totals span.price.price--end{font-size:15px}cart-items .title-wrapper-with-link h1.title.title--primary{font-size:28px}th.caption-with-letter-spacing{font-size:14px}.cart__footer-wrapper .cart__footer .cart__blocks .cart__ctas button{justify-content:center}.cart-item__details .product-option,.cart-item__totals span.price.price--end{font-size:13px}.drawer__inner .pro_available span{font-size:15px;line-height:1.27}.cart-item__details .cart-item__name{font-weight:500}.cart_page cart-items.is-empty{padding-bottom:40px}}@media screen and (max-width:749px){.cart_trust_badge li img{margin-top:-1px}}